LN Media & Sponsorship || Brand Associate
Live Nation Entertainment is the world’s leading live entertainment company, and they are seeking a Brand Associate to manage relationships and activities with top corporate brands. This role focuses on program activation, financial performance, and client relationship management within the Media & Sponsorship division.
Responsibilities
- Represents Live Nation with a commitment to integrity, respect for others, inclusivity, collaboration and professionalism
- Provides professional, responsive service to and communication with clients that ultimately exceeds expectations and builds trust between the client and Live Nation
- Contributes to the successful delivery of contractual assets including planning, execution, and reporting that optimizes program performance and proactively identify or resolve any challenges with asset delivery
- Coordinates client status calls/meetings including the preparation of agendas, distributing pre-read materials, stewarding discussions, and delivering post call notes that supports the progression and delivery of client programs
- Supports the planning and execution of key client activations across Live Nation assets including venues, festivals, promotions, media, hospitality, and content programs
- Ensure accurate, on-time financial reporting for sponsorship programs by processing invoices, reconciling expenses to budget, managing client billing, and maintaining Salesforce profitability plans
- Gathers, analyzes, and packages key metrics, learnings and growth opportunities into program recaps that demonstrate delivery of objectives and return-on-investment, delivering these with analytical business results and key insights
- Develop and grow relationships with key Live Nation teams (i.e. Digital, Content Production, Legal, Finance, etc.)
- Explore market trends, emerging technologies, and best practices to add value to sponsorship programs
